Network Engineer 4

Responsibilities
- Author technical proposals, white papers, design documents, operator network designs, RFI/RFPs, and patent filings.
- Assist in product and feature performance analysis, evaluate new product and software releases, and third‑party product evaluation to build product synergies.
- Provide expert technical support in the pre‑sales process and develop technical and commercial solutions to help achieve sales goals.
- Translate and communicate complex technical design considerations between the sales team and carriers’ network business.
- Educate customers on the company’s new products and services, individually and in teams.
- Collaborate with support organizations, logistics, and cross‑functional teams from SEA and HQ to achieve successful product rollouts and developments.
- Lead field integration testing (FFA/FIT/FSA) of 4G/5G key features with customers, including test plan development, review with customers, and driving cross‑functional teams to execution.
- Handle Tier3 support: analyze and troubleshoot scheduler issues reported from customer labs, field sites, and production networks.
- Review and recommend improvements to LTE RAN network performance by evaluating and trending key KPIs, performing trials, and providing optimization guidelines.
Qualifications
- Undergraduate engineering degree with 8–10 years of directly related experience; a master’s degree and 8+ years of experience preferred.
- Possess 4G/5G call processing experience with deep knowledge of RRC, S1‑MME, S1‑U, X‑2 protocols, and concepts such as massive MIMO, new waveforms, LTE‑NR interworking and coexistence, 5G numerologies, etc.
- Fluency with 3GPP RAN product architecture, design, implementation, and performance improvements (KPIs); a good understanding of scheduler functionality is a plus.
- Experience with system engineering: feature requirement identification, feature description documentation, parameter optimization, performance analysis, test strategy creation, and troubleshooting.
- Deep understanding of 3GPP specifications for LTE, LTE‑A, and 5G features and protocols, and experience with current 3GPP Rel‑15/16 activities.
- Working knowledge of various RF antenna technologies and network optimizations.
